> The Debian Documentation project seems to be progressing really
> slow. Could we do the following things.
>
> 1) Set up the DDP CVS so that all Debian developers can use it. This
> way perhaps DDP gets more contributors.
Already done. All developers, in fact, anyone with an account on
va.debian.org, can use the system.
> 2) Engourage maintainers of packages with system administration
> fuction to provide usage notes, for example to the System
> Administrators Manual.
I continue to strenuously object to non-Debian documentation being
forked off into Debian and not considered as a problem of free
documentation in general.
> Are there any plans to move to DocBook? I have not seen anything on
> this subject during the last half year. Hopefully I am not stirring up
> a hornets nest.
Not at all. I personally am agnostic regarding use of DocBook versus
Debiandoc-SGML. However, I have seen very few (well, no) cases where
the limitiations of DebianDoc-SGML have hampered us too strongly.
